Oc-windows.ru

IT Новости из мира ПК
0 просмотров
Рейтинг статьи
1 звезда2 звезды3 звезды4 звезды5 звезд
Загрузка...

Join now for access

Join now for access

Here is what other guitarists who have experienced the Academy are saying about it.

If you are interested in learning this style of playing, these videos and lessons within the Academy are invaluable. For instance, I had been learning to play ‘Still Awake’ just by watching Tobias play it on YouTube, and I also had bought the Tab awhile back from his website. I could get parts of it to sound close, but not exact, and I could not figure out what I was missing, or how to emulate something the exact way he does. In the Tobias Academy, I got to watch videos of him explaining exactly how he plays each part, and I realized all the little things that I had been missing, that I would have never otherwise caught, without his help and detailed explanations. From what I have seen so far it looks awesome and is extremely helpful! I recommend.

Jay Page Academy Student

I’ve really been enjoying practicing with the videos, they’ve helped me become more comfortable with percussive guitar techniques and writing my own songs. Joining the Academy was the best thing I could do. Each week I look forward to next weeks modules and the next batch from the riffbox. I highly recommend to join the Academy if you are into percussive fingerstyle.

Brandon Leslie Academy Student

I have been playing in the guitar academy for a full year now, and it has been really helpful. Before my subscription, I tried to learn Still Awake, but it didn’t sound as perfect as the original. The step-by-step tutorials gave me the opportunity to catch the little details I missed. The academy itself helped me improve my own playstyle. Ten on ten!

Samuel DesRoches Academy Student

Wow! your course is amazing Tobi! really thanks for giving us the opportunity to learn from you! It’s a shame i have only 1 free day per week these months x_X.

Rodrigo «Hyke» Quintana Academy Student

I had the honor of being a part in the academy from day one and I really really like it. The academy has got a great structure and is very thorough. Personally I love the modular structure and the riffbox riffs as I get motivated to play so much more than I used to.

Daniel W. Academy Student

About Me

Hi my name is Tobias Rauscher, I am a professional modern percussive fingerstyle guitarist and YouTuber from Germany. Besides performing, I have taught students of all ages how to play the guitar for more than 15 years!

With more than 35 MILLION VIDEO VIEWS on YouTube, countless guitarists have contacted me for lessons. This is how I came up with the idea of creating a hub to provide my knowledge and lessons on percussive fingerstyle guitar. Here, you can access all of my material, learn techniques, and practice at your own pace — anytime and anywhere!

I have been consulting my students and conducting surveys to determine what like-minded guitarists like yourself want to learn. Based on my findings, I developed an in-depth methodology to teach modern percussive fingerstyle. Having tested my concept in private lessons and through workshops, I am now proud to present my academy to you.

Frequently Asked Questions

Get answers to some frequently asked questions. If you aren’t able to find the answer to your question,
please get in contact with me by clicking on the button below.

What should my skill level be for this academy?

My academy is aimed at advanced beginners up to professional guitarists who want to take their playing to the next level.

You should at least be able to play standard chords (open and bar chords), and able to use you fingers independently (e.g. able to play basic scales and melodies.) Also, you need to have some experience in fingerpicking. It is recommended that you have played the guitar for at least one year.

The basic percussive fingerstyle course is ideal for beginners, as I will be instructing from square one. The rest modules are more advanced, with each one starting with the basics and progressing in difficulty level.

How much time can I expect to spend per week?

You will be provided with new content on a weekly basis (modules and Riffbox Riffs.), and sporadically (song tabs & song courses).

Of course, this does not mean that you have to practice it on the same week. As a member, you can access all of the material anytime – this includes the weekly content. You can learn at your own pace, take lessons and practice riffs wherever and whenever you want! That being said, I highly recommend that you practice on a weekly basis.

What are the payment options?

There are two well-known and secure payment methods available: PayPal and Stripe

PLEASE NOTE: As my academy is subscription based, you need to have a valid credit card. Ideally, your credit card will already be linked to your PayPal account so you can subscribe monthly.

If you don’t have a credit card, you can still purchase your plan of choice with a one-time payment via your PayPal balance.

If you don’t have a credit card, PayPal or Stripe, please get in contact with me to arrange another payment method.

How and when can I cancel?

Since this is a monthly subscription model, there are no binding contracts, traps or pitfalls. This means that you can cancel your subscription at any time with the click of a button.

Читать еще:  Ошибка 2950 в access 2020

For your peace of mind, there is a rock solid 30 day money-back guarantee – no questions asked!

Access Now

Access Now to join the Paris Call for Trust and Stability in Cyberspace

Today, Access Now will be endorsing the Paris Call for Trust and Stability in Cyberspace (Paris Call) in support of a more peaceful internet with stronger protections for users and human rights. The Paris Call will be a landmark deal launched during the Paris Digital Week , including the Paris Peace Forum (PPF) and Internet Governance Forum (IGF), in which those endorsing will reaffirm their commitment to the applicability of human rights online and support for a more secure cyberspace. While the deal is far from perfect, its commitments largely benefit users, including users at risk, and will reinforce valuable norms of behavior online.

The Paris Call is a multi-stakeholder effort of government, companies, and civil society, though primarily led by government and company stakeholders. President Emmanuel Macron of France will launch the call at IGF on November 12. As we wrote last week, the IGF and PPF are a part of the broader Paris Digital Week where user protections should be high on the agenda. Access Now participated in drafting the Call, including in support of language encouraging coordinated vulnerability disclosure. We recognize, however, that the process was not adequately inclusive for civil society and that civil society must also be involved in the implementation. When those endorsing the Call reexamine it in a year, we hope to see structured outreach to more civil society organizations, and at an earlier stage.

Why we signed

Protecting peace in the digital era must mean strengthening user protections against governments that undermine the security of the internet. There is the growing risk that “online sovereignty” will become the prevailing theme in international cybersecurity policy. A coalition of countries that includes Russia and China has introduced resolutions at the United Nations that emphasize state sovereignty online over human rights. Sovereignty can justify overbroad data collection and government hacking, internet shutdowns, restrictions on expression based on poorly defined standards of hate speech or terrorist content, and limits on the security of platforms, all in the name of the needs of the state.

Meanwhile, the current insecurity of internet platforms and connected technology leave users at high risk of data breaches and direct attacks. Companies must take responsibility for poor security decisions. That is why we support efforts like the Paris Call that recognize the responsibility of all actors, including the private sector, in strengthening the security of platforms and services.

Ultimately, the Paris Call will reinforce other efforts to improve protections for users and their rights. Just yesterday, the Global Commission on the Stability of Cyberspace , a body that works “to promote mutual awareness and understanding among the various cyberspace communities working on issues related to international cybersecurity” released a new package of norms that aim for a more peaceful cyberspace. Those norms overlap with the commitments of the Paris Call, including the need to address vulnerabilities, the harm of private-sector offensive hacking operations, and the recognition of the value of cyber hygiene.

What the Paris Call includes

Near the top of the Paris Call will be reaffirmations of the applicability of international law, in particular humanitarian law and human rights law, to cyberspace. Putting human rights near the top of the Paris Call is an indication of importance. The rest of the Paris Call will help when answering questions about how human rights apply online.

In our last blog post on Paris Digital Week, we addressed a number of commitments that should come out of Paris. Many of those protections will be included in the Paris Call. For example, the Paris Call commits those endorsing to strengthening cyber hygiene. To us , that means promoting tools like multi-factor authentication and virtual private networks (VPNs). While the Call does not make reference to encryption, it does urge the strengthening of products and services, which often involves encryption.

The Call also recognizes the range of ways in which all actors must work, often together, to improve cybersecurity. Both state and non-state actors play a role in helping victims of cybersecurity attacks. We play our own role in assisting victims through our Digital Security Helpline . We work collaboratively with other non-governmental organizations that also help prevent attacks and recover from those that take place.

How the Paris Call should be improved

As we noted, the Paris Call is not perfect. We hope to see a reevaluation of certain commitments when the parties reconvene next year. Two in particular warrant particular discussion and Access Now accordingly places reservation on their endorsement.

First, the Paris Call promotes cooperation between stakeholders to address the threat of “cyber criminality.” Judicial orders should be the basis for any assistance between providers and law enforcement. Cooperation, on the other hand, can be interpreted to mean informal exchange of data or the intentional weakening of platforms to enable law enforcement access. As such, “cooperation” is not the proper framework for the relationship between law enforcement and companies.

The Paris Call also refers to the Budapest Convention, a global cybercrime treaty that attempts to harmonize national laws, as a “key tool.” Civil society has critiqued the Convention’s broad definitions of criminal actions can hamper security research. The Council of Europe is developing an additional protocol to the Convention that would extend law enforcement’s ability to reach data stored across borders. It is yet to be seen whether the additional protocol will be crafted with adequate human rights protection given the risks.

Читать еще:  Склад на access

Second, the Paris Call includes a commitment from stakeholders to prevent theft of intellectual property, including trade secrets, using information and communication technologies. Calling for “prevention” suggests a heavy-handed approach that could limit the flow of information online and risk freedom of expression and the right to privacy. We were concerned that references to intellectual property would be contained in the document, which is why we reserve support for this provision.

We also hope to see additions to the Paris Call next year. First, while the Paris Call urges limits on private sector actors “hacking back,” it does not adequately address the risks of government hacking . The UN Human Rights Council singled out hacking as a threat to the safety of journalists. Jamal Khashoggi may have been spied on through invasive malware beforehand his murde r. Government hacking is not only a threat to user privacy, it can also undermine the security of platforms.

Finally, the Paris Call does not make explicit that protecting security often means protecting personal data. The next Paris Call should recognize the need for robust data protection and security measures, breach notification schemes, and privacy-by-design principles. Similarly, the Paris Call should address the widespread use of surveillance by governments which impacts users’ rights.

User-centric cybersecurity

The Paris Peace Forum and the Paris Call mark 100 years since the end of World War I. The actors that meet there will help set the security agenda for the next 100 years. At Access Now, we believe that the next 100 years must be about reinforcing and extending existing protections. To achieve that, cybersecurity should be user-centric, systemic, and anchored in open and pluralistic processes . Despite the need for improvements, the Paris Call can help achieve those goals.

Join now for access

6353+ people were not wrong choosing SmartAddons Club. Get access to all our clubs within 3 minutes.

Step 1

Step 2

Step 3

per 3 month

  • 1 Domains License (?)
  • Access to All Templates (?)
  • Access to All Extensions (?)
  • Source Files (.psd)
  • Copyright Removal (?)
  • Access to AppStore Templates
  • No Discount (?)
  • Support Forum / Ticket

per 6 month

  • 5 Domains License (?)
  • Access to All Templates (?)
  • Access to All Extensions (?)
  • Source Files (.psd)
  • Copyright Removal (?)
  • Access to AppStore Templates
  • No Discount 10% (?)
  • Support Forum / Ticket

per 1 Year

  • Unlimited Domains License (?)
  • Access to All Templates (?)
  • Access to All Extensions (?)
  • Source Files (.psd)
  • Copyright Removal (?)
  • Access to AppStore Templates
  • No Discount 30% (?)
  • Support Forum / Ticket

per 3 month

  • 1 Domains Limit (?)
  • Access to All Templates (?)
  • Access to All Extensions (?)
  • No Discount (?)
  • Support Forum / Ticket

per 6 month

  • 5 Domains Limit (?)
  • Access to All Templates (?)
  • Access to All Extensions (?)
  • No Discount 10% (?)
  • Support Forum / Ticket

per 1 Year

  • Domains Unlimited (?)
  • Access to All Templates (?)
  • Access to All Extensions (?)
  • No Discount 30% (?)
  • Support Forum / Ticket

Frequently Asked Questions

Frequently asked questions for our Joomla! Templates Club memberships.

1. Template Membership: After you join the club, you will immediately access the download area of the templates. There you should find your favorite template and download it. You will see two parts for each download: The Source Files and The All In One Package. The All In One Package contains all the files that are necessary to install the template on the site: the Template file, the Cloner Installer to make your site exactly like the demo, all the modules, components and plug-ins included in that template and of course the documentation guide. The Source Files package contains the Adobe Photoshop files so that you can easily edit the design part of the template.

2. Extension Membership: After you join the club, you will immediately access the download area of the extensions. There you should find your favorite extension and download it.

Соединение таблиц – операция JOIN и ее виды

Говоря про соединение таблиц в SQL, обычно подразумевают один из видов операции JOIN. Не стоит путать с объединением таблиц через операцию UNION. В этой статье я постараюсь простыми словами рассказать именно про соединение, чтобы после ее прочтения Вы могли использовать джойны в работе и не допускать грубых ошибок.

Соединение – это операция, когда таблицы сравниваются между собой построчно и появляется возможность вывода столбцов из всех таблиц, участвующих в соединении.

Придумаем 2 таблицы, на которых будем тренироваться.

Таблица «Сотрудники», содержит поля:

    >

    idИмяОтдел1Юлия12Федор23АлексейNULL4Светлана2

Таблица «Отделы», содержит поля:

    >

    idНаименование1Кухня2Бар3Администрация

Давайте уже быстрее что-нибудь покодим.

INNER JOIN

Самый простой вид соединения INNER JOIN – внутреннее соединение. Этот вид джойна выведет только те строки, если условие соединения выполняется (является истинным, т.е. TRUE). В запросах необязательно прописывать INNER – если написать только JOIN, то СУБД по умолчанию выполнить именно внутреннее соединение.

Давайте соединим таблицы из нашего примера, чтобы ответить на вопрос, в каких отделах работают сотрудники (читайте комментарии в запросе для понимания синтаксиса).

Читать еще:  Access ошибка 2950

Получим следующий результат:

idИмяОтдел
1ЮлияКухня
2ФедорБар
4СветланаБар

Из результатов пропал сотрудник Алексей ( >

Если не углубляться в то, как внутреннее соединение работает под капотом СУБД, то происходит примерно следующее:

  • Каждая строка из одной таблицы сравнивается с каждой строкой из другой таблицы
  • Строка возвращается, если условие сравнения является истинным

Если для одной или нескольких срок из левой таблицы (в рассмотренном примере левой таблицей является «Сотрудники», а правой «Отделы») истинным условием соединения будут являться одна или несколько срок из правой таблицы, то строки умножат друг друга (повторятся). В нашем примере так произошло для отдела с >Перемножение таблиц проще ощутить на таком примере, где условие соединения будет всегда возвращать TRUE, например 1=1:

В результате получится 12 строк (4 сотрудника * 3 отдела), где для каждого сотрудника подтянется каждый отдел.

Также хочу сразу отметить, что в соединении может участвовать сколько угодно таблиц, можно таблицу соединить даже саму с собой (в аналитических задачах это не редкость). Какая из таблиц будет правой или левой не имеется значения для INNER JOIN (для внешних соединений типа LEFT JOIN или RIGHT JOIN это важно. Читайте далее). Пример соединения 4-х таблиц:

Как видите, все просто, прописываем новый джойн после завершения условий предыдущего соединения. Обратите внимание, что для Table_3 указано несколько условий соединения с двумя разными таблицами, а также Table_1 соединяется сама с собой по условию с использованием сложения.
Строки, которые выведутся запросом, должны совпасть по всем условиям. Например:

  • Строка из Table_1 соединилась со строкой из Table_2 по условию первого JOIN. Давайте назовем ее «объединенной строкой» из двух таблиц;
  • Объединенная строка успешно соединилась с Table_3 по условию второго JOIN и теперь состоит из трех таблиц;
  • Для объединенной строки не нашлось строки из Table_1 по условию третьего JOIN, поэтому она не выводится вообще.

На этом про внутреннее соединение и логику соединения таблиц в SQL – всё. Если остались неясности, то спрашивайте в комментариях.
Далее рассмотрим отличия остальных видов джойнов.

LEFT JOIN и RIGHT JOIN

Левое и правое соединения еще называют внешними. Главное их отличие от внутреннего соединения в том, что строка из левой (для LEFT JOIN) или из правой таблицы (для RIGHT JOIN) попадет в результаты в любом случае. Давайте до конца определимся с тем, какая таблица левая, а какая правая.
Левая таблица та, которая идет перед написанием ключевых слов [LEFT | RIGHT| INNER] JOIN, правая таблица – после них:

Теперь изменим наш SQL-запрос из самого первого примера так, чтобы ответить на вопрос «В каких отделах работают сотрудники, а также показать тех, кто не распределен ни в один отдел?»:

Результат запроса будет следующим:

idИмяОтдел
1ЮлияКухня
2ФедорБар
3АлексейNULL
4СветланаБар

Как видите, запрос вернул все строки из левой таблицы «Сотрудники», дополнив их значениями из правой таблицы «Отделы». А вот строка для отдела «Администрация» не показана, т.к. для нее не нашлось совпадений слева.

Это мы рассмотрели пример для левого внешнего соединения. Для RIGHT JOIN будет все тоже самое, только вернутся все строки из таблицы «Отделы»:

idИмяОтдел
1ЮлияКухня
2ФедорБар
4СветланаБар
NULLNULLАдминистрация

Алексей «потерялся», Администрация «нашлась».

Вопрос для Вас. Что надо изменить в последнем приведенном SQL-запросе, чтобы результат остался тем же, но вместо LEFT JOIN, использовался RIGHT JOIN?

Ответ. Нужно поменять таблицы местами:

В одном запросе можно применять и внутренние соединения, и внешние одновременно, главное соблюдать порядок таблиц, чтобы не потерять часть записей (строк).

FULL JOIN

Еще один вид соединения, который осталось рассмотреть – полное внешнее соединение.
Этот вид джойна вернет все строки из всех таблиц, участвующих в соединении, соединив между собой те, которые подошли под условие ON.

Давайте посмотрим всех сотрудников и все отделы из наших тестовых таблиц:

idИмяОтдел
1ЮлияКухня
2ФедорБар
3АлексейNULL
4СветланаБар
NULLNULLАдминистрация

Теперь мы видим все, даже Алексея без отдела и Администрацию без сотрудников.

Вместо заключения

Помните о порядке выполнения соединений и порядке таблиц, если используете несколько соединений и используете внешние соединения. Можно выполнять LEFT JOIN для сохранения всех строк из самой первой таблицы, а последним внутренним соединением потерять часть данных. На маленьких таблицах косяк заметить легко, на огромных очень тяжело, поэтому будьте внимательны.
Рассмотрим последний пример и введем еще одну таблицу «Банки», в которой обслуживаются наши придуманные сотрудники:

idНаименование
1Банк №1
2Лучший банк
3Банк Лидер

В таблицу «Сотрудники» добавим столбец «Банк»:

idИмяОтделБанк
1Юлия12
2Федор22
3АлексейNULL3
4Светлана24

Теперь выполним такой запрос:

В результате потеряли информацию о Светлане, т.к. для нее не нашлось банка с >

idИмяОтделБанк
1ЮлияКухняЛучший банк
2ФедорБарЛучший банк
3АлексейNULLБанк Лидер

Хочу обратить внимание на то, что любое сравнение с неизвестным значением никогда не будет истинным (даже NULL = NULL). Эту грубую ошибку часто допускают начинающие специалисты. Подробнее читайте в статье про значение NULL в SQL.

Пройдите мой тест на знание основ SQL. В нем есть задания на соединения таблиц, которые помогут закрепить материал.

Дополнить Ваше понимание соединений в SQL могут схемы, изображенные с помощью кругов Эйлера. В интернете много примеров в виде картинок.

Если какие нюансы джойнов остались не раскрытыми, или что-то описано не совсем понятно, что-то надо дополнить, то пишите в комментариях. Буду только рад вопросам и предложениям.

Привожу простыню запросов, чтобы Вы могли попрактиковаться на легких примерах, рассмотренных в статье:

Ссылка на основную публикацию
Adblock
detector